NORFOLK, Va. - Old Dominion University football practiced for the seventh time this spring on Tuesday morning.

Dressed in shorts, shoulder pads and helmets, the two hour practice began with special teams, punt and kickoff, and featured position drills, inside run, 7 on 7 and team drills.

Following practice the players participated in the annual Special Olympics Little Feet Meet at Powhatan Field.
